Expect moving costs from Knoxville to Bridgeport to vary based on your household size and service needs. Small moves range from $1,114 to $1,148, medium moves from $1,281 to $1,320, and large moves from $1,448 to $1,492. Prices fluctuate due to dist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es ensures you find the best fit for your budget.

Here are common questions about moving from Knoxville, Tennessee to Bridgeport, Connecticut to help you plan your relocation.
Moving costs vary by home size and services chosen. Small moves range from $1,114 to $1,148, medium moves from $1,281 to $1,320, and large moves from $1,448 to $1,492. Additional services like packing or storage can affect the final price.
Standard delivery from Knoxville to Bridgeport usually takes about 2 days. Expedited delivery options can reduce this to 1 day, depending on the moving company and scheduling.
The most affordable option is typically a self-service move where you pack and load your belongings. Full-service moves with packing and storage will cost more but offer greater convenience.
Booking several weeks in advance can secure better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ons like summer to reduce costs.
Yes, reputable moving companies operating interstate must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and protection.
Plan for transit time, packing needs, and possible storage. Confirm delivery windows and verify the moving company's experience with interstate relocations.
